Let me get this straight. In season 1, Wu JingHao travelled back to highschool days. Which is timeline 2 In season 2, Han Fei travels back to university day; a timeline that Wu JingHao was in before but an alternate ending. (timeline 3)
In timeline 1, Han Fei is dead and Wu Jinghao was a loser who was saved by Han Fei and felt guilty hence he travelled back in time to save Han Fei --> Timeline 2. (SEASON 1)
In timeline 2, Wu Jinghao saved Han Fei but dies in highschool hence only Han Fei was able to finish university and become a doctor. (SEASON 1 + SEASON 2)
In timeline 3, Wu Jinghao loses his memories of Han Fei's accident and Han Fei had never died in highschool. This is a time where both of them havent died in highschool and went to university. However because they both never died, Wu Jinghao didnt travel back because of guilt which means Han Fei and Wu Jinghao are just acquaintances (SEASON 3)
